Sinopec Shanghai Petrochemical (SHA:600688, HKG:0338) forecasts it will swing to an attributable loss of between 418 million yuan and 511 million yuan in the first half, against an attributable profit of 27.9 million yuan in the year-ago period.
The oil company attributed the foreseen loss to the downward trend of crude oil prices, as well as dismal market demand, the filing said.
Shares fell 5% in Hong Kong and 2% in Shanghai during morning trading on Tuesday.
